Govt to make sure basic supplies are maintained

Pixabay

The government is to boost the office which is in charge of making sure the country has enough food and other essential supplies.

At the beginning of the pandemic some essential shortfalls were obvious – especially medical equipment.

The ongoing crises in Ukraine means more government intervention is required, says the Federal Council.

While Switzerland’s needs are served essentially by a market economy – and that’s not going to change – the Economic Supply Office will see its staff boosted by 12. 

Federal Councillor Guy Parmelin says the country lacks self-sufficiency in vegetable oils and wheat. 

The government recommends that households should store nine litres of water per person and have enough food for a week at all times. 

Also there should be a reserve of basic medications as well as batteries, flashlights and facilities to cook without electricity.
